Between the STI Piston one, the Momo with the leather top half and the shpherical all titanium knob from the 6spd sti . What are the adavantages of each?

 

I would imagine the Momo with the leather top half would be the most comfortable as far as temperatures were concerned but I want to get a few opinions.

 

Anybody have experience with these?

The Momo balls feel perfect it the hand. I can only imagine the "piston" wouldn't feel too nice. I bought the full leather Momo Race Air ball, doesn't feel cold in the winter or hot in the summer, and it is a perfect match for the perforated leather on the Momo steering wheel.

The stock knob in the '02 WRX had very rough stitching that got irritating after a very short time of spirited driving (maybe I should of been wearing gloves? :lol: ). So I swapped it for a Momo Super Anatomic. I tried the Momo Air Leather in the store (similar to the upgrade knob, but all leather), but didn't particularly like shifing with a billiard ball. :D

 

I don't think I'll be changing out the stock knob in my GT Wagon as it's feels and fits just fine to me.
